Pelicans Forward Anthony Davis Named Starter on Western Conference All-Star Team

NEW ORLEANS – New Orleans Pelicans forward Anthony Davis has been named a starter on the NBA Western Conference All-Star team, the league announced today. Davis, a fourth-time All-Star, joins Chris Paul as the only other player in franchise history to be named an All-Star starter at least twice. Davis is also the second player to be named to at least four All-Star teams in franchise history, again joining Chris Paul.

Davis, 23, is averaging 28.8 points, 12.1 rebounds and 2.4 blocks per game, ranking him third, sixth, and second in the NBA in each statistical category, respectively.
